Abstract

This essay analyzes the exchange rate in Brazil and assesses the trend of free floating, focusing the first ten years of Plano Real (1999-2009) based mainly on the New Developmentalism (ND) approach. The hypothesis is that the trend of overvaluation of exchange rate, especially between 2002-2007, combined with the rise of commodity prices in the international markets and weakness of Brazilian competitiveness have harmed the economic growth, manufactured industrial output and trade balance in Brazil. Thus, there are macroeconomic evidences of Dutch Disease ongoing in Brazil, driving by a low local value added generation and weakness in Brazilian competitiveness.
